SANTA FE, N.M. ‌(AP) — New details have emerged​ regarding‍ the deaths of actor Gene Hackman and his wife, Betsy Arakawa, ‌who were found​ deceased ​in their Santa Fe home‌ in February. A recent report‌ from ‍the New Mexico Office of the⁢ Medical Investigator sheds light on the ‍circumstances surrounding their ‍passing.

Cause of Death and Contributing Factors

Hackman, ⁣95, died‌ of hypertensive and atherosclerotic cardiovascular disease (ASCVD), with⁤ Alzheimer’s⁢ disease‍ listed as a meaningful contributing ⁣factor,​ according to the report. Arakawa, 65, passed away seven days prior to Hackman, also from⁤ natural causes.

Hackman’s Condition and​ Final Toxicology Report

The medical investigator noted that‌ Hackman was in‌ an “advanced state” of Alzheimer’s disease. The report suggested it⁢ was​ “quite possible that he⁤ was not aware” of his wife’s death. Investigators found ‌no‍ food in hackman’s stomach​ at the time ​of his death.

Toxicology reports indicated findings⁢ consistent with prolonged fasting, revealing trace amounts of acetone​ in his system. This is a product of‍ diabetic and fasting-induced ketoacidosis, according⁣ to fox News Digital.

Discovery and Initial Investigation

The couple ‌was discovered on Feb. 26 by maintenance workers who alerted the caretaker of their ‍gated community, who​ then called 911. ‍ arakawa was found on ​the ⁤floor of a bathroom, while Hackman was located in a mudroom⁣ near the kitchen. A walking cane and ⁢sunglasses were found near Hackman’s body.

One of ‌the couple’s dogs, an Australian Kelpie mix named Zinna, ‌was found dead in ​a closet. Two other dogs appeared healthy.

Initial Suspicion‍ and Search ⁤Warrant

While the sheriff’s office initially found no signs of foul play, investigators deemed the circumstances “suspicious ‍enough” to warrant a thorough investigation, according to⁣ the search warrant. The front door was ajar, and⁣ there were no ⁢signs of forced⁢ entry or carbon monoxide⁤ poisoning.

One ⁣deputy noted that⁢ arakawa’s body was partially decomposed, with mummification around her hands and⁣ feet.​ Hackman’s body showed similar​ signs.‍ A worker told​ investigators he⁣ had last⁤ spoken ‌with the couple about two weeks prior.

Private Memorial Service

Hackman and Arakawa were laid to⁣ rest in a ⁤private memorial ‌earlier this month. Hackman’s children, ⁢Christopher, Elizabeth, and⁣ Leslie, along with other​ family members and friends,⁤ attended the service.

Alzheimer’s Impact

Examination‍ of Hackman’s brain revealed microscopic⁣ findings of advanced-stage Alzheimer’s disease. Remote myocardial⁢ infarctions were also present, involving ‌the left ventricular free wall‌ and the septum.

Gene Hackman and Wife Betsy Arakawa’s cause of Death ​Revealed

SANTA‍ FE, N.M. (AP) — The causes of death for actor Gene Hackman, 94, and his wife, Betsy Arakawa, ⁤84, have been persistent, weeks after they‌ were found dead in their ‍Santa ‍Fe home. Arakawa’s death was attributed to hantavirus pulmonary syndrome, while Hackman suffered from advanced Alzheimer’s​ disease and heart disease, according to authorities.

Community remembers ⁤Hackman and Arakawa

Hackman, ‌an Academy ​Award winner, had largely retreated from public‍ life in recent years, residing quietly in ‌santa Fe with‍ Arakawa. Locals remember ​him as approachable and unpretentious. “He was ⁤just a regular guy,” one resident told the *Los Angeles ​Times*.

Jennifer Pins, Santa⁢ Fe’s film commissioner, noted ⁤that Hackman and Arakawa were “deeply woven into the ⁢fabric of Santa​ Fe.”

hackman’s⁤ Declining Health

Prior to their deaths,sightings of Hackman ⁤had become increasingly rare,particularly after the onset‌ of the COVID-19 pandemic. Daniel Lenihan,‌ a friend, told *Peopel* magazine that the⁢ actor ​had ‍become “essentially kind of home-bound” ⁢recently. Lenihan’s son,⁤ Aaron, said Arakawa had been dedicated to keeping Hackman active and⁢ healthy. However, Daniel Lenihan noted that Hackman had been “really slipping.”

Barbara Lenihan, daniel’s⁣ wife, described Arakawa, a classical pianist, as being ⁣in “perfect⁤ health” and‍ “so fit.”

Investigation Details

Initial ​concerns about⁣ carbon monoxide poisoning were ruled out. Sheriff Mendoza told reporters on⁤ Feb. 28 that tests for⁤ carbon monoxide poisoning were negative. However, he cautioned that complete autopsy and toxicology ⁣results could take three months or longer.

The New Mexico Gas Company reported on March 4 that ​a “minuscule leak” was discovered in a‍ stove burner, but it did ​not emit enough carbon monoxide to be fatal. The investigation did not reveal any other leaks or gas​ line​ problems.

Investigators noted several code violations in the home, but ​none related to gas or carbon‌ monoxide.

Official Cause of ⁤Death Findings

New Mexico ⁢Chief Medical Examiner Dr. heather Jarrell announced on march 7 that‌ Arakawa died from hantavirus pulmonary syndrome, a rare respiratory illness‌ contracted through⁤ exposure to rodent droppings, urine, or saliva.

Hackman “showed evidence of ⁢advanced Alzheimer’s disease,”​ Jarrell ⁣said. “He was in a very poor ​state of health.⁢ He⁢ had significant heart disease, and I ⁢think ultimately that’s what resulted in his death.” Arakawa may have exhibited flu-like symptoms before ⁤her death, according to the medical examiner.

Erin Phipps,⁤ New Mexico state ‍public health veterinarian, stated that the couple faced a “low risk” of exposure within their house, but there were indications of rodents in other structures on the property.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ention reports that between 1993 and 2022, New ⁤Mexico recorded ⁣122 cases ⁤of hantavirus ⁤and 52 ⁤deaths.

Timeline of Events

According to the coroner, Arakawa, last seen running errands on Feb.⁢ 11, appeared to​ have died approximately one week before ‌hackman. Hackman’s pacemaker activity suggested⁤ he died on Feb. 18, a day later than ⁢initially reported.

The bodies were not discovered until eight days later, 15 days after Arakawa’s death.

Authorities believe Hackman was alone in the house with his wife’s body until his own death.

“It’s quite possible he was‌ not‍ aware she was deceased,” Jarrell ​said.She also‍ noted that‍ Hackman had no food in his stomach at the time of death, but he was‍ not dehydrated.

Their dog, Zinna, was found dead in a crate in the bathroom, succumbing to starvation and ⁢dehydration, according to Phipps.

Gene Hackman’s Wife, Betsy Arakawa, Death Timeline Disputed

SANTA FE, N.M. (AP) ​— The⁢ timeline surrounding the ⁤death of betsy Arakawa,wife of actor‍ Gene Hackman,is​ facing scrutiny after conflicting reports ‍emerged regarding the date of her passing. Arakawa died a ​week before Hackman, but ⁢the exact date of her death is under investigation.

Sheriff’s Investigation and Initial Findings

On March 7,Sheriff Mendoza⁣ stated that the investigation had not revealed any⁢ evidence of a‌ caretaker residing at the Hackman residence. ​According ‌to ‌a ⁤friend, tom Allin, Arakawa managed Hackman’s affairs for years, arranging his social engagements. Allin told *The New York Times* that he primarily communicated with Arakawa, even ​though he had known⁢ Hackman for two‌ decades.

Allin described⁢ Arakawa as “very protective” of her husband,adding that Hackman⁣ “would have died long ago” without her care.Another friend, Ashman, expressed remorse‌ to *The Washington Post*, lamenting that those close to hackman should have been more attentive. “I had no idea…It’s just really sad. And⁢ that she died⁣ a week before him.My God,” Ashman said.

Arakawa’s Last Day: Errands and Activities

Authorities⁢ believe Arakawa’s last day included emailing ‌her massage therapist in the⁤ morning, followed by errands ⁢to ⁢a⁣ grocery ⁣store, pharmacy, and ​pet store in the afternoon. She returned ⁤home around 5:15 p.m. and ceased responding to emails after⁢ Feb.11.Sheriff ​Mendoza noted that⁢ Arakawa ​habitually wore a mask while running errands, a precaution reportedly taken to ​protect her‍ husband from potential⁢ illnesses.

Conflicting Account: doctor Claims Contact After Reported Death

An unexpected twist‌ in the timeline has emerged.While⁤ the coroner initially determined Arakawa died around Feb. 11, a local doctor claims to ⁢have spoken with her the following⁤ day.

Dr. Josiah Child, ‍who runs ⁣Cloudberry Heath in Santa Fe, told the *Dailymail* in a March⁢ 17 interview that Arakawa ⁢called his​ office on the morning​ of Feb. 12. “She called back on the morning of ‌February 12 and spoke​ to one of our doctors⁣ who told​ her to come in that afternoon,” Child said. “We made her an‍ appointment, but ⁢she never showed ⁢up.”

child ⁢clarified that⁤ the appointment ⁣was ⁢unrelated to hantavirus. “We ⁣tried calling her⁤ a couple of times with no reply,” he added.

Investigation Continues

The discrepancy in the timeline is under further investigation as authorities seek ⁢to clarify the ⁤circumstances surrounding Arakawa’s death.
